☐ Step 4 — Fernpath offline-mode key escrow. Fernpath is the field-survey app used by Bryle Surveys crews; its offline mode caches signed plot data on ruggedized tablets. During this ceremony, the escrow officer splits the offline signing key and seals two shards in tamper-evident bags. Reviewer confirms bag serials match the ledger and that no shard leaves the room unsealed. Reassembly is permitted only at a declared incident. The shard vault opens with the passphrase recorded below.

vault phrase of fahog-yajof = istael-zorwyn

# Break-Glass: Catalog Cache Invalidation

Scope: the Pinrow product catalog at Veldstone Retail. If stale prices persist after a purge and the Hollowmere invalidation queue is wedged, use break-glass to flush the edge tier directly. Contractors: get verbal sign-off from the catalog lead first. Steps: open the Hollowmere admin shell, select emergency-flush, confirm the tenant, and run it once — repeated flushes thrash the origin. Access is logged and expires after 20 minutes. Unseal the admin shell with the passphrase below.

recovery phrase for kahop-tajog: istix-casvan

Building access — first-aid room, Tarnwick Works. Contractors on site must know the location: ground floor, corridor C, opposite the tool crib. Open during staffed hours 07:00–19:00. Outside those hours the room is locked but accessible in an emergency. Do not remove supplies for routine use; report anything used to the site office the same day. Defibrillator is wall-mounted inside, left of the sink. For after-hours entry, key the code below into the door pad.

door code, tahop-fahap: bdg-JZCXMY-37375484